		<description>actually it's just a garage and warehouse.

the actual daily news brooklyn printing plant
is smack-dab in the middle of ratnerville on pacific street east of 6th avenue.
it will not be torn down ...bldg now known as the "newswalk" condos.
plant was active until the late-90's, when the news moved all of its printing to new jersey.</description>
